The effectiveness of Ziegler-Natta catalysts in producing high-quality polyolefins is heavily dependent on the precise formulation of their components, including internal and external electron donors. Dicyclopentyldimethoxysilane is recognized for its ability to modify the stereospecificity of these catalysts, promoting the formation of highly isotactic polypropylene. This not only enhances the mechanical properties of the polymer, such as stiffness and tensile strength, but also contributes to better thermal stability. For those seeking to improve their polypropylene polymerization catalyst systems, this organosilane is a key ingredient.
Furthermore, the inclusion of Dicyclopentyldimethoxysilane in polymerization recipes has been shown to positively impact the molecular weight distribution and melt flow index of polyolefins. This granular control over the polymer architecture is critical for tailoring materials for specific applications, ranging from high-strength films to durable molded articles.
